Buenos Aires is an older Jacksonville pocket where the housing stock does the pricing, not the address. With a median year built of 1942 and homes ranging from 1926 to as recent as 2024, the median sale price here is far less about location premium and far more about what shape a given house is in. Two homes on the same block can sit far apart on price depending on how much of the original 1940s bones have been updated. Condition is the story.
The median footprint is compact at roughly 1,487 square feet, so this is small-to-modest housing on the whole. Homestead share sits at about 45%, meaning a majority of these homes are held as something other than a primary residence — that tells a buyer to expect a mix of owner-occupied and investor-held property, and to underwrite condition carefully. Sellers with a genuinely renovated home have room to stand apart; sellers with deferred maintenance should price honestly.

An age-driven market
The defining fact here is age. A median build year in the early 1940s means most homes carry the systems, layouts, and lot patterns of their era — and the real variable between listings is how much has been touched since. A buyer should budget for inspection and, on many properties, for roof, electrical, and plumbing that reflect the home's vintage. The presence of construction as new as 2024 shows there is infill and rebuild activity, so the same street can pair original cottages with brand-new builds.
With about 140 homes in the count and a homestead share under half, turnover and non-owner ownership are part of the picture. That can mean opportunity for a buyer willing to renovate, and it means a seller with documented updates should lead with them. Compact square footage keeps carrying costs and scope manageable, which suits a buyer who wants to improve a home over time rather than buy one already finished.
The location and the amenities are priced into every listing in Buenos Aires. The deal is won or lost on condition, the comps, and the renovation math.
